Neural DSP Archetype Parallax X is a versatile all-in-one tool for crafting powerful and modern bass tones on Mac, bringing every essential processing stage together within a single plugin. It is built around the concept of parallel processing, a technique that has been used for decades to achieve dense, articulate, and aggressive bass sounds in professional productions.

Traditionally, parallel bass processing demanded complex routing setups involving multiple plugins or separate signal chains, where upper frequencies were distorted for clarity and cut-through while the low end remained tight and controlled. Neural DSP Archetype Parallax X plugin completely reimagines this workflow, delivering fully featured parallel processing inside one intuitive and streamlined interface designed to run smoothly on Mac systems.

The low-frequency range is handled by a dedicated compressor that has been specifically engineered for bass guitar. This approach preserves the foundation of the mix and delivers a sense of massive size and unwavering stability, even when the remaining frequency bands are pushed into aggressive territory with extreme settings.

The midrange and high frequencies are processed independently using a proprietary tube-stage model. This ensures rich harmonic content, natural dynamics, and a musical response that reacts organically to your playing technique and touch sensitivity.

Midrange distortion adds density and improves note articulation, making the bass far more intelligible and defined within a busy mix. High-frequency distortion lets you dial in the exact degree of aggression you need, ranging from subtle grit and mild roughness all the way to tight, focused, and saturated fuzz tones.

A built-in six-band graphic equalizer provides an additional layer of tonal control, allowing you to precisely shape the frequency balance and tailor the overall sound to fit a specific mix, genre, or playing style on your Mac workstation.

Neural DSP Archetype Parallax X Mac features a bass cabinet emulation module with six virtual microphones whose positions can be freely adjusted for maximum flexibility. The cabinet emulation is applied exclusively to the mid and high-frequency bands, which preserves the purity and raw power of the low frequencies. The frequency response characteristics of the cabinets shape the distortion in an especially musical and pleasing manner.

The transpose function allows you to shift the tuning of your instrument up or down within a full octave range, simplifying work with alternate tunings without having to physically retune your bass guitar. The plugin also includes a built-in chromatic tuner for quick and accurate instrument tuning before sessions.

For practice sessions and live performances, the Neural DSP Archetype Parallax X download includes a standalone mode of operation. Within this mode, a built-in metronome is available with adjustable time signature, accent patterns, and note subdivisions, making this plugin a convenient and practical tool not only for studio recording and mixing but also for rehearsals and live stage use.
